BillboardMax offers digital billboards, where approved static digital creatives rotate among scheduled advertisers and can be changed without printed-vinyl production. Static billboards use a printed face that typically remains in place for the contracted period. BillboardMax highway digital billboards use static digital creatives, not video.
Yes. BillboardMax can help prepare or validate billboard-ready creative, including layout, message hierarchy, sizing, and vendor specification checks. Design assistance does not replace vendor approval; the final artwork must still meet operator, roadway, content, and technical requirements.
Timing depends on live inventory, campaign confirmation, payment, creative readiness, vendor review, and the selected start date. Digital campaigns can often avoid printed-vinyl production, but no launch date should be treated as final until the locations and artwork have been approved.

Many digital billboard campaigns can run for as little as 30 days, with shorter campaigns possible at an equivalent campaign budget depending on the market and screen. BillboardMax measures standard campaign periods in 30-day increments.
Yes. Active clients receive online campaign tracking with visibility into locations, dates, impressions, and campaign delivery. Play- or flash-level and billboard-level delivery data is available where supported.
